What Integrity Means in Mexican Business Culture

In Mexico, integrity isn’t just a buzzword—it's the foundation of any successful business negotiation. Mexicans value personal relationships deeply, and a deal is not just a transaction; it's an exchange of trust. When you sit down to negotiate, it's expected that you come with your word as your bond. You see, in Mexico, "Mi palabra es mi ley" (My word is my law) isn’t just a saying; it’s a way of doing business.

Relationships Over Paperwork

While many countries focus on contracts and fine print, in Mexico, relationships are the backbone of any agreement. Integrity shines through in the way Mexicans prioritize building trust over hastily signing papers. If a handshake happens, you can bet that there’s a solid understanding behind it. It’s this commitment to people over paperwork that makes Mexican business culture unique and successful in the long run.

Honor and Reputation: The Mexican Business Pillars

In Mexico, reputation is everything. A person's honor and the trust others place in them can be the deciding factor in closing a deal. Mexican entrepreneurs will often say, "No hagas tratos que te avergüencen" (Don’t make deals that will shame you). This speaks to the heart of business integrity. It’s about making sure your actions align with your word and that you maintain a reputation as a person who honors their commitments, no matter the cost.

The Art of Respectful Negotiation

Mexicans have a knack for negotiating with grace and respect. They understand that business isn’t a race to the finish line but a journey where each step must be carefully considered. Integrity comes into play when both parties feel heard and respected. It’s not about winning at all costs—it’s about finding a mutually beneficial solution. So, whether it’s negotiating terms or discussing a compromise, Mexicans make sure that respect for the other party is always present, creating a win-win outcome for everyone involved.
